How Much House Can You Afford in Troy?
Understanding the Median Price
The median home price in Troy is $442,000. This gives you many choices. At Sonic Loans, we often hear, "What can I afford?" It depends on your income, debts, and down payment. Follow the 28/36 rule. Your mortgage should be no more than 28% of your income. Total debt should be no more than 36%. This helps you manage your money well. Understanding these guidelines can help you make informed decisions and prevent financial strain.

What Are Your Down Payment Options?
FHA and Conventional Loans
First-time buyers in Troy have many down payment choices. FHA loans need just 3.5% down. They're good for those with okay credit. Conventional loans have good rates for those with strong credit. They need 3% to 20% down. These options give you flexibility. Understanding the pros and cons of each loan type can help you choose the best fit for your financial situation.
VA Loans and MSHDA Programs
VA loans offer 0% down for veterans. This honors their service. The Michigan State Housing Development Authority (MSHDA) helps first-time buyers in Michigan. Many don't know about these programs. Pre-Approval vs Pre-Qualification: Why It Matters
Understanding the Difference
Know the difference between pre-approval and pre-qualification. Pre-qualification is a quick check based on what you say. Pre-approval is a deeper look by a lender. 5 Mistakes Troy First-Time Buyers Must Avoid
Overlooking Hidden Costs
Don't miss hidden costs of owning a home. These include taxes, upkeep, and insurance. At Sonic Realty, we make sure you know these costs. Being ready helps keep your money stable after buying. Additionally, consider setting aside funds for unexpected repairs or maintenance needs that may arise.
Skipping the Home Inspection
Don't skip the home check. It's key to spot any problems before you buy. We've seen deals fail due to missed issues. A good check can save you. Our team stresses this step to protect your buy. Inspections can reveal structural issues, outdated systems, or pest problems that might not be immediately visible.
